Internet & Online Businesses, Uncategorized

The Most Popular PostgreSQL Trigger

Make TRIGGER creates another trigger. Triggers empower us to characterize capacities to be executed at whatever point a specific sort of activity is finished. Imperative triggers aren’t an answer.

In such a situation it’s enticing to utilize triggers. For example, you may set up a trigger that will execute each time a line is embedded in a foreordained table or at whatever point a specific section is refreshed in a table. Triggers are a piece of the SQL standard and are useful in applications that are information serious in nature. So section trigger isn’t the absolute best thing I think.

Related image

Make language plpgsql that is required for trigger. Triggers are naturally dropped while the table they’re related with is dropped. The trigger can utilize IF or CASE articulations to adjust its conduct contingent upon the parameters. The manner in which many individuals are acquainted with is to simply incapacitate all triggers on the table. Looking More visit PostgreSQL trigger.

Our trigger currently turns into more confused. This trigger will be executed once for a specific activity. Triggers are an exceptionally successful component that could improve the proficiency of any application by methods for a database. On the off chance that you attempt to erase a trigger that doesn’t exist without utilizing the IF EXISTS condition, you will get a mistake. You should note you should make an unmistakable trigger for each table, which is certifiably not a tremendous thing.

Subtleties of PostgreSQL Trigger

SELECT doesn’t adjust any lines with the goal that you can’t make SELECT triggers. The CASCADE choice can assist you with dropping all articles that depend on the trigger naturally. 1 utilization of triggers is to support a synopsis table of some other table. Superior applications may wish to empower keep-alive and association steadiness to reduce inertness and improve throughput. Numerous applications require watching out for when database records are made and refreshed. Databases are imperative with respect to contemporary web applications. Building a site which utilizes databases has a ton of points of interest.

Given the abovementioned, you may think about whether ordinary limitations are liable to definitely a similar issue. Capacities might be utilized as triggers, which is what we’re keen on. Second, the capacity itself may get a blunder. Our capacity is practically identical to the past one. These trigger capacities become executed when the trigger is terminated. Database trigger capacities are very helpful when it has to do with applying consistency decides that include numerous tables. As a framework develops progressively vigorous, it definitely gets not adequate to store the current situation with the records.

PostgreSQL Trigger Fundamentals Explained

Indexes are consequently made for essential significant limitations and unmistakable requirements. A solitary section index is one which is made reliant on only one table segment. Interesting indexes are utilized for execution, however also for information trustworthiness. An extraordinary index doesn’t allow any copy esteems to be placed into the table. An index in a database is incredibly a lot of like an index in the back of a book.

Execution tuning isn’t trifling, yet you can go far with a couple standard rules. Luckily Postgres triggers grant you to make a review log for every single table in your framework effortlessly. PostgreSQL is absolutely free and open source program. Fortunately, PostgreSQL is ground-breaking enough to supply a perfect solution for such issue. So for example, a DROP CASCADE could simply should get replayed as a DROP CASCADE.

Leave a comment